Type
ORACLE
Validation date
2024-12-20 16: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02162,
    "usd": 0.02248
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A14B31CB13800B334964ACEDC360D802FA4CDD72C68A2D5CD552E62A0ADB3ABD

Previous signature

BABEB647156F8EC939B85192F53EA82228AF97AEC0CD3A63B5D8A738AC102DB0957E45E86E67B7916BD5EA5900725168125E9CF025ADED9EA02CC2C9C6A9840F

Origin signature

3046022100AE566F9C80A39E2FFA22B31E2605335E2CCDC78F9B4EE38DE382FD9430E15B3F02210084AF9A3B6A732208B12D35D804B5EE474CEF267B0AC370BCD961A23A723CFC0D

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

001552396643D5D2383DFD35A1BE89A4C8AAE356E684FF8467D103CF204DDF542C

Coordinator signature

48C720DD7633DAD7BA100ACE8CE397094482DE9C84C6552D63DD2174247CE20507F4D1B077856727DAB8A154CEEB62F5CFDA771A00F3137DCE276596101C7903

Validator #1 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#1 signature

8E00207DD9C6DCDE0378B6F55FACC8A17A4A72C2214D7F8FE31D0C9C79CC7913739DF76D7DC705E4D8020E4D2578AB89DCFDD561EF030814D4FA8A3771986902

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

B43B890D6C1787B40B4246C5C17599CC17ABA0EA236CBED8DA0961956C1359AA51105F4BBA3B9ABC4F3608FFDCA905C20E4913F498EF8C047AD5D1616F475309